Under intense heat, the effect is limited. However, under normal, even brutal, sun exposed condition (like the Salton Sea scenarios I've tested the compound on), I won't be going back to other dressing or methods. This 303 is on all my gears now. Just make sure not to apply on your rod's handle. I use it all over the house, car, kayaks, and even float tube.
